Abstract

The present invention provides a wear liner assembly () adapted to be secured to a structure (). The wear liner assembly comprises a wear liner () having a first material secured to a backing plate (). The backing plate has at least one hole () therethrough. A first fastener portion is adapted to co-operate with a second fastener portion to securing the wear liner to the structure. The first fastener portion is received in the at least one hole and is at least partially housed within the wear liner.
